Safety Advice For Truck Drivers

Owen Jones | August 20, 2011

The first safety tip for every driver of road vehicles is to take care of yourself properly. In other words, make sure that you have had enough rest and that you have been well fed and watered. If you take medication, be sure that you have taken it. You should also take care of your general level of fitness by taking regular exercise. All the above will help you remain alert and responsive but also stave off drowsiness.

A similar attitude ought to be taken towards your vehicle. This means frequent routine maintenance. This regular routine maintenance will be second nature to professional truck drivers anyway, and it will include checking the tyres for pressure and wear and checking pipes and leads for damage.

The last thing you want while you are diving down a motorway is to have a tyre or hose blow out. We have all seen substantial chunks of rubber on our roads, which are the results of such blow-outs. They are perilous to the truck driver and anyone else driving behind.

It is not usually the professional truck drivers who cause problems, but any qualified driver can hire a truck and some drivers become a little rusty. Once you get behind the wheel of a vehicle, you are accountable for it, so be sure that it is fit for use. If you are picking up a trailer, make certain that all the lights and brakes work on that too.

Awareness but alertness are two of the most vital safety factors for the divers of any vehicles, and especially truck drivers, because they are driving such huge but weighty vehicles. These substantial vehicles have their own special concerns that cars do not have.

For instance, they might have blind spots, they may become less manoeuvrable, they might become harder to stop yet the load might be perilous. Even if all that is a fact, it is still not normally the professional driver who will cause an accident. Rather it could become the Sunday driver, the kid with the stolen vehicle, the drunk driver or even just someone who has forgotten to take their spectacles with them

Truck drivers have to not only not create mistakes, but they have to anticipate yet get on the look out for the mistakes of other drivers. This is why it is so important for the driver to get alert, which equals taking supervision of the driver’s health but fitness.

Another manner of taking care of the driver is to always wear your safety belt. If there is an accident, the truck diver is almost sure to be the most experienced driver around and therefore the most helpful person there until the police and safety / rescue personnel become there. There ought to also be a fire extinguisher in the cab, whether the load is perilous of not.

The weather conditions can vary a great amount for long distance truck drivers, so it is a good idea to be aware of the local conditions and to have clothing appropriate to it. After all, you will have to get out of the cab at some time. For the same reasons, it is a sensible idea to have an effective heater and air conditioner.

A hands-free mobile phone is an essential part of anybody’s safety equipment, and a conscientious truck driver should also report any dangerous incidents to the police – items like substantial road kill, debris, reckless drivers and accidents.

Stained Glass Workshop Safety Suggestions

Owen Jones | July 9, 2011

Safety in the workshop is a big issue, but if one is working with glass, it becomes a very big subject. The crafts person or artisan who works with stained glass has particular dangers to be aware of. As we all know, glass can be sharp, and if you cut glass the powder is very dangerous and old stained glass can contain dangerous chemicals for pigmentation and lead to hold the pieces together.

The first bit of advice is never to take young children to a stained glass workplace. This is because of the risk of them cutting themselves on broken glass and inhaling the powder of dangerous chemicals. So, if the children are involved with choosing a design, take the catalogue to them in the car, do not take them to the workshop.

If you have to carry a sheet of stained glass to the car for self-installation, wear gloves that have rubberized surfaces so that you can obtain a good grip without having to grip the sheet of glass tight. Hold the sheet of glass by the side edges if you possibly can. If you hold it top and bottom ant it breaks, the arm at the bottom may be struck by falling, jagged glass.

If you are working with stained glass at home as a hobby, make certain that your environment is spotless. It is usually easier to score and break glass on a soft surface like a bed sheet. A blanket is too thick and gives too much, which may cause the glass to break in a way that is unwanted.

Whilst cutting glass, always wear a mask and safety glasses. or even safety goggles for improved protection. This is particularly the case if you would like to cut the glass with an angle grinder. The glass powder created by a grinder is very perilous.

While you are soldering the lead strips to hold the fragments of stained glass in position, make sure that you follow safety procedures with the soldering iron. Put it into a holder, so that when you reach for the soldering iron, you can only grab it by the cool handle with no chance of you being able to grip it by the hot end.

Solder fumes are not healthy for you, so make certain that your workplace is well ventilated with extractor fans. Wear gloves too so that your skin does not suffer from repeated contact with toxic lead. If you have a cut or a wound, put a plaster on it so that the lead does not get into you too easily.

If you do not have a workplace or even a garden shed, do not be tempted to do the work in your home, because the fumes and the glass powder will build up and you will never really get rid of them. The dust and fumes are serious pollutants and will build up in textiles, so if you have curtains in your workshop, wash them regularly and vacuum everywhere at least once a week.

How Browser Cookies Have A Negative Effect On Everyone’s PC Privacy and Anonymity

Cindy Marshson | May 29, 2011

A cookie is text file that a browser sends to a web server when a customer visits a website. This is stored on the customer’s computer the first time he or she accesses the site. It is also known as a web cookie, browser cookie, or HTTP cookie. Once stored, the browser uses this file to navigate the website more effortlessly. Some of its uses are for log ins, themes, language settings, shopping cart contents and more features that use text data.

A cookie may or may not have an expiration date. One that does not have an expiration date is automatically erased as the browser is terminated. One that has an expiration date may be stored by the browser and deleted as the expiration date passes. Although a cookie itself does not hold information, it can help a website to operate more fully.

Cookie files contain the name of the server, its duration, and the cookie value. The value that makes a cookie unique is a randomly generated number. This helps the server that created the cookie to recall the user when he or she comes back to the site or to navigate through pages. These cookie files are kept in the browser’s “cookie file”.

A cookie is not executable, meaning that it cannot imitate itself like a virus. In some cases however, it can be a privacy concern. A browser is capable of setting and reading cookies, so a cookie like the “zombie cookie” or an “evercookie” can be used as spyware. As spyware, a cookie can be used to keep track of a user’s online activity. That is why users can decide not to accept cookies delivered by websites.

A cookie just helps the website to identify the user and keeps a record of his or her information. It cannot do damage to the computer by itself since it cannot access the user’s hard drive. For example, a user does not need to input his name every time he or she visits the same site. The website may ask the user to key in his or her name the first time he or she visits the site and the next time he or she visits the site, the cookie tells the server who he or she is. Consequentially, as the website opens, it already includes his or her name.

Privacy dangers can be an issue in the use of cookies. All personal information uploaded by a user will be remembered by the cookie. This can expose the user to the possibilities of identity theft or computer hacking. This is one of the reasons why some users would want to delete cookies stored in their computers.

There are various ways of deleting cookies, depending on the user’s browser, however, the process can generally be done in three steps for Internet Explorer.

First, on the browser, go to “Tools”.

Second, select “Internet Options”.

Third, under the “General” tab, choose “Delete Cookies”. The rest may be a combination with other functions. The user may choose to delete all cookies or just select which ones to delete.

Why Do Children Sleepwalk?

Owen Jones | May 14, 2011

Sleepwalking or somnambulance is a strange sleep disorder that affects up to fourteen percent of children at some time before they are teenagers. Around a quarter of them will experience more than one episode of sleepwalking. For some reason, more boys than girls sleepwalk but most somnambulists grow out of the issue before they are teenagers.

Sleepwalking is in fact a brain disorder as well as a sleep disorder, but it is a brain disorder of the nervous system which normally corrects itself as the sufferer matures. By way of explanation, usually, when people wake up, the whole body and whole brain wake up together, whereas with sleepwalkers, the mobility part of the brain and the body wakes up, but the cognitive/awareness part of the brain stays asleep, at least for a short time.

At least that is one clarification, because as with so many items to do with the brain, no one really knows, all that can be agreed by everyone, is that the child is still in a deep sleep when it is wandering around.

When the child is wandering around, the eyes are open, but the face appears extraordinarily impassive. The child can see but still trips or stumbles and still bumps into things. Usually, the child will not listen to a conversation or react to hearing its name.

The most prevalent time for an bout of sleepwalking to take place is within the first two hours of sleep. The periods of somnambulance normally last from fifteen minutes to two hours and the sleepwalker may get dressed and venture outside.

Although it is wise to bring this condition to your doctor’s attention, no remedy is normally necessary other than putting better security on all exterior doors and locking windows at low level to prevent the child from leaving the house.

They normally grow out of sleepwalking sooner or later. If you child sleepwalks, all you ought to do is guide it back to bed without waking it up unnecessarily. It is not dangerous to wake up a sleepwalker, but not essential either.

Roughly one percent of adults sleepwalk as well, and this one percent are not inevitably the ones who sleepwalked as children. Adult sleepwalking usually has other more mundane causes such as stress, worry and insomnia or even some medical conditions such as epilepsy. When the reason goes away so does the sleepwalking.

Treatments differ considerably relying on the severity of the ‘sleepwalk’. Does the sufferer merely go down and sit in the living room or does the sufferer open the door and go outside where there is heavy traffic? Hypnotism is one treatment.

There are other safety measures that people living with sleepwalkers can or perhaps should take. Because sleepwalkers are prone to bumping into items, make certain there is nothing projecting anywhere that could poke them in the eye. Hang bells or wind chimes in places where they tend to go and on doors that they use in order to alert you that they are on the move.

Lock certain doors with deadbolts and take the key out and finally make sure that all low-level glass is toughed and covered by curtains at night so that they do not try to walk through them without first opening them.

What is the Informed Consent Law plus How Can it Affect You

Frank Andrew Greenwald | April 30, 2011

The informed consent law has been into the news just of late. The approach it is being executed now has pushed some groups to suggest for improved ways. The Colorado Progressive Coalition for example expressed its call for improved implementation. One suggestion it has laid down was to educate both law enforcers as well as civilians on the new law. Informing the police alone and not the civilians would not guarantee the full strength of the law.

According to the law, a search can only be executed after the consent of the subject. If he or she refuses, then no search can be completed. To avoid from committing privacy violation, the law enforcer ought to complete the required process. He or she should first clearly explain to the subject his or her rights under the law. Once the subject refuses, the police officer can not go on with the intended search.

The law that specifies those provisions is named HB 1201. This condition is under the 4th Amendment, defending individuals against unreasonable searches. Consent of the person is required in order to make the search reasonable. This is in response to the various incidents concerning brutal treatment of civilians by the law. This is usually associated with those cases when individuals would not permit police search. The main purpose is to instill respect of the law for both police and civilians.

The Colorado Progressive Coalition hosted one round table event. During the said occasion the two fundamental aspects on the implementation of the law were discovered. One is the creation and implementation of training programs for law officers. The other is creating public interest of the law and legal rights of citizens. These two would create a partnership between both law enforcement and civilians because they understand their rights. This means that there would be less cases of police maltreating private individuals.

There are numerous ways of implementing training programs for law enforcement representatives. The presently used means is through training bulletins sent through emails. Furthermore group suggests that this is not enough to build up “a culture that respects the law”. There must be other means that would support deeper knowledge and appreciation of the law. Video webcast education is viewed as the best medium that would make sure proper implementation of the law.

Public awareness is also critical. The ACLU has signified its available resources for providing know-your-rights classes. It would be teaching individuals who are willing to learn the new Colorado law as well as their rights as citizens. It also said that they would provide know-your-right cards to individuals who are interested in promoting the informed consent law.
